BMD Shows Support in Memory of Jason and Jeff Hall

On Saturday, 28 June 2014, a Memorial Day was held for brothers Jeff Hall and Jason Hall, friends of the BMD family, who tragically passed away in a car accident in the Hunter Valley earlier in the year.

BMD assisted with the organisation of the Memorial Day which included two football games involving friends, colleagues and former team mates. The inaugural Jeff and Jason Hall Memorial Shield was presented by parents, John and Carole Hall, to the winning team of the day, the Warren Bulldogs.

Post-match auctions were conducted with local community members raising over $17,000 in support of the families. BMD donated a 2014 signed North Queensland Toyota Cowboys jersey to help raise money for the brother’s families which was sold off in the auction.

BMD would like to thank the North Queensland Cowboys for their generosity in donating a signed player’s jersey and their assistance in making the Memorial Day an unforgettable event.

BMD is a national group of companies engaged in engineering design, construction and land development for clients and partners in the urban development, transport infrastructure, resources and energy sectors.

Since 1979, BMD has employed a relationship based business model founded on certainty, collaboration and performance.

With approximately 1,700 staff throughout Australia, BMD has the resources and experience to deliver projects ranging in size from $1 million to over $1 billion and is currently ranked 36th in the 2013 BRW’s Top 500 Private Companies list and 3rd in the 2013 Brisbane Business News’ Top 100 Private Companies.
